Our current heating system is showing signs of distress. In this winter alone, it has failed eight times, leaving students and staff shivering in chilly classrooms. As the large building struggles to regain warmth, some classrooms have experienced temperatures as low as 57°F during the winter. Unfortunately, the cost of replacing the system far exceeds our available building funds. We face a critical challenge: how to maintain a comfortable learning environment without compromising other essential needs. Schools are becoming a prime target for cybercriminals who want to steal data, extort money, or disrupt education. Montana is not immune to this threat. The number of phishing links to Montana school district employees that made it through email filters and security tools increased a staggering 1,100% last year. Each of these emails come with the potential of an attack that can cost a school district time, money, and resources. West Valley Technology Levy will be utilized to help protect student data and privacy through cybersecurity subscriptions and personnel. Help support the school’s efforts to safeguard the digital learning environment for students and staff. As mandated by the state, West Valley School District conducts benchmark testing three times a year and administers standardized tests annually. However, there’s a significant hurdle: the lack of funding for a benchmark testing platform. Unlike the past, when paper-and-pencil assessments sufficed, today’s testing landscape is exclusively computer based. Unfortunately, West Valley receives no financial support to provide the necessary devices for students to complete these assessments. Let’s bridge this gap and empower our students with the tools they need for successful testing in the digital age. West Valley School District has already made tough decisions, reducing the budget by $250,000. Unfortunately, this has led to an increase in class sizes as four staff positions have not been filled. Smaller classes mean more effective teaching and better student outcomes. Should the levy not pass, several additional teaching positions will be lost. Let’s prioritize our students’ well-being and create an optimal learning environment through retaining important staff positions.
